Amphetamine
Amphetamine is a potent central nervous system stimulant used to treat att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and narcolepsy.
Euphoria
A sensation or condition of profound joy and exhilaration.
Barbiturate
A class of drugs derived from barbituric acid that act as central nervous system depressants, used in the treatment of insomnia, epilepsy, and anesthesia.
